Output e85a2e601d891d2124c7c4ffcec3fdc40d39a9cfa7dde1d311d2a01b1d5ed6ed:1

value
2644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436ceb2cc3424c294a8c55b2f999cf29aa8e1be1 OP_EQUAL
address
37qXgCNviPcd7ZzJLAYcxp8cmfnv6n4Z4K
transaction
e85a2e601d891d2124c7c4ffcec3fdc40d39a9cfa7dde1d311d2a01b1d5ed6ed
confirmations
149405
spent
true